## Account Recovery — Trailnote Offline Mode

When a surveyor's Trailnote app has been offline for 30+ days, their local credentials expire and sync refuses to resume. Don't make them wipe the device — all their unsynced field data lives there! Instead, open the support console, pick "Offline Reinstate," and enter their handle. The console will ask for the support team's shared recovery passphrase before issuing a reinstatement token. Use the one below.

unlock words, bagaf-fajeg: zorael-kelax-fraath-quenix-eliok-sileth-aldmir-wenir-druiel

## v2.8.0 — EXIF Scrubber Update

Plugin authors: the Pictoria EXIF scrubbing module now strips GPS and serial-number tags by default, with an opt-in allowlist for orientation data. Because the scrubber binary moved to its own release channel, we rotated the artifact signing key; plugins must verify against the new key before loading the module. The previous key expires at the end of the month. Verify future releases with the following key.

signing key of bagap-yawep = bky13_TbfT6ZMUoGJo2

## Configuration

The Ospreyline dispatcher assigns drivers using a weighted heuristic: proximity (50%), recent idle time (30%), and completion rate (20%). Weights are tunable via `ASSIGN_WEIGHTS` but validated at boot; malformed values fail closed and no assignments occur. All heuristic inputs are read-only snapshots, so a compromised worker cannot influence scoring mid-cycle. Scoring requests to the Marrowfield ranking service are signed per-request, and the signing credential is read from the environment, beginning with the line below.

sealed setting: COURIER_KEY29=58d9ea6bce2b68ce7faee67385abf